Recently, I ventured back to Asia for the summer, and since there are quite some stackers curious about the good practices when it comes to crossing International borders: #146039 #426711 #64784, sharing some of my setups here, maybe it could be useful for fellow Bitcoiners:)
1. Low-key is the Key
First things first, the best way to protect anything is to avoid even attracting any attention. Seriously, I don't understand why people bring their well-known hardware wallets and seed plates to the airports, where cameras are EVERYWHERE, or even wear big logo BTC t-shirts...
The best way to protect yourself is to blend in with the crowd, and ideally, everything you carry doesn't even show a sign of Bitcoin; let's be real: Bitcoin is money, so why would you show off your money in public? Thus, the best way to protect your corn is not even showing it, e.g., you should NEVER keep your seeds the way even the naked eye of strangers can easily understand them.
Here are some of the simple solutions to protect the seeds:
-
Write a poet or story with the seeds ( optionally leave 2-3 words out, and mix with other methods)
-
Build your cold wallet with TailsOS and store the seeds with built-in KeePassXC
-
Make it into half or three pieces, and put it in different places: it can be digital, meat place, or a mix of both.
-
Use your memory.
Always do backups.
Also, apply different methods for different sizes of stash and use different levels of energy to protect them; Be creative, but always keep it simple! and make it in a way that only you can "decode" it even if it's lying out in the open.
2. The Art of Subtle Settings
Since most of us use phone or laptop to engage with Bitcoin, here are some of the setups that I tested and learned:
π± Phone
I use Slient link ( data only ) with Mullvad VPN, both paid in LN, and this combo has been working really well so far. The most tricky part on the phone is the LN wallets due to the channels closing and reopening all costs sats, not to mention need to do the seeds back up again; here are the solutions I found, and I guess it depends on the risk level of the destinations or how paranoid you are:
For the careful ones
- Set your phone in a language that the locals can't understand.
- Remove all Bitcoin-related wallets from home screen.
- Purposely make your phone dead when crossing the border.
For the paranoid ones
- Close all LN channels, delete ALL Bitcoin-related apps even with a factory reset, and download some normies apps.
- Simply keep your phone at home and bring a dummy phone for travel.
However, there's a new feature coming in Blixt v0.7.0 that you won't need to close all channels for the migration, and that would make the deletion less painful, looking forward to testing it.
π» Laptop
Since I work online, the laptop is a way of production for me, so I developed a habit of wiping it from time to time to make sure I'm backing up EVERYTHING as mentioned here; Also, whenever before long trips, I always double-check my backups then left it somewhere safe, and I carry an extra encrypted drive with everything I need for daily functions.
βπ½ Level Up
- Use Veracrypt to encrypt the important data and unlock it once you are back in a normal environment.
- Use TailsOS, and keep the data in the encrypted persistent storage.
3. Learn How to Defense
However, in case you are being pulled out and asked to be searched, you need to prepare yourself in advance, e.g., how to ask the right Qs, not giving your consent etc, here is one of the good places to learn more.
Also, one reminder is that once you are well protected your Bitcoin ( if you haven't done this step yet, go back to 1 ), NO ONE can take it away from you, this is something really powerful once you understand it.
Spending
The ideal way to travel is using Bitcoin and exchanging local currency without any KYC, but of course, the best is spending in sats directly; Once you cross the border, you can either use Sparrow or even Blue Wallet ( if you are on the go without a laptop ), all you need is to put back the seeds, and done; also, nice to prepare some small emergency funds so that you don't need to touch your savings; And ideally, you swap the sats into Lightning and spend from there.
And see more here on how to exchange local currency, I assume this is easier in where you are based or live; it can be tricky when you are traveling somewhere for a short time, but here is some of the solutions : exchange with local friends ( the BEST ) -> try to meet Bitcoiners in local Bitcoin cafes or events -> Bitcoin ATM if available, and not with huge fee -> non-KYC exchanges.
At the same time, try to see where you can spend in sats, or even pilling as you go.
βοΈ Flights
One of the options to pay in sats is to use travala. Still, I'm a bit reluctant to give away my details to any third parties, so I usually book directly with the airline, and I'm using a specific fiat card for it. π I actually don't want to link the fiat name with a "paid in BTC" tag; I often see people use the visa card to covert their sats into fiat, why not select the specific ones to spend with fiat and slowly switch them in the process? and don't forget to book your flight with a VPN.
Some paid in sats alternatives shared by stackers: travala | tapjets ; However I haven't try them out yet, feel free to share your experience:)
π Accommodations
I usually use Airbnb, and I would try to pill the hosts if I decide to extend or come back again, I normally use Blink to keep things simple; In places where Airbnb is not available, or if I can't find any good options, then I try to find hotels in Maps and pay in cash, some places even give you discounts if you pay in cash.
Some paid in sats alternatives shared by stackers: travala | airbtc ; However I haven't try them out yet, feel free to share your experience:)
π΄Food
I prefer trying out local restaurants whenever I'm traveling, especially those small family restaurants, honest and fair prices with real local taste, and are generally quite pleasant. One more hack is once you found a good one, try to ask for recommendations and go from there:) locals know the best.
I prefer paying food in cash, and I usually buy directly from local farmers if I'm based somewhere longer, and pill the restaurants that I go to all the time, you can look around in BTCmap to see where you can pay in sats, but pilling the ones you love is the best! No need to be afraid or feel awkward, you are not going to lose anything with a simple ask, but the upside is unlimited.
Good places to look around: BTCmap | farmfood , but you can always pill the ones you like like I did: I , II , III
π€ Bonus: Other Nomad Hacks
-
Always carry some
cash
, cash is still king. -
Avoid going to places full of influencers and classic tourists if you want to have a more authentic experience.
-
Use a carry-on bag only for short distant trips, which is massively saving time.
-
Make sure you have the right adapter for all your electrical equipment.
-
Bring your own (Turkish) towel instead of using whatever is being offered; not only it's lightweight and dry fast, but it does not even take up much space!
-
Bring a scarf with you, not only can it be used when it's cold and when visiting certain religious or holy places to cover yourself, but it can also be used as a fashion item.
-
Learn some basic words about the place where you are going, which not only shows some respect but also locals would be so much nicer to you.
-
Order things in advance to the place where you will be staying.
- Private: It's not your real address, and no need to use your fiat name; ideally, you even pay for the products in sats.
- Time-saving: no need to wait for your delivery anymore, it might be already there before you arrive.
( would you like to learn more hacks? )
Digital life
-
Always do backups before any travels and encrypt it with Veracrypt.
-
Slient link + Mullvad VPN = Internet without borders.
-
Sms4sats for some of the unimportant Apps' one-time verification.
-
Deep L for translation.
-
Mapsme for offline map.
Related good posts
That's all for now, looking forward to learning more hacks from fellow stackers! π